Main information about car part TOYOTA 12371-17040
Producer TOYOTA
Number 12371-17040 / 1237117040
Group Engine Mounting
Description Engine Mounting
MOTORSILENTBLOCK; Rod Assembly
Analogue of TOYOTA 12371-17040
ASHIKA ASHIKA GOM-2166 GOM2166 Engine Mounting
JAPANPARTS JAPANPARTS RU-2166 RU2166 Engine Mounting
JAPKO JAPKO GOJ2166 GOJ2166 Engine Mounting
MDR MDR MEM-82166 MEM82166 Engine Mounting
PEMEBLA PEMEBLA JAPRU-2166 JAPRU2166 Rod Assembly
TOYOTA TOYOTA 1237117070 1237117070 MOTORSILENTBLOCK